12:24 am One Has All The Goodness by James (PG)
Fandom: PRIDE AND PREJUDICE
Pairing: Elizabeth Bennet/Fitzwilliam Darcy; Lydia Bennet/George Wickham
Length: 18,000 words
Author on LJ: Unknown
Author Website: The Derbyshire Writers' Guild

Why this must be read:

This delightful story is completely canon-based, which is not as common as one would think in Austen fandom. The author tells his tale completely from Fitzwilliam Darcy's point of view, and does so very well. Indeed, much of the dialogue is almost, dare I say, Austen-esque, while the descriptions paint a vivid picture of early 19th Century London.

The story begins shortly after Fitzwilliam Darcy arrives in London to search for the eloped (but unmarried) Lydia Bennet and George Wickham. He is determined to find them and separate them if possible. If not, Wickham must be convinced to marry Lydia.

The author depicts Darcy as being a man of great passion and feeling, but a man who does not show such feelings in his expression or demenour, which is consistent with how Jane Austen wrote him. Some readers might be startled at how intensely the author describes Darcy's inner thoughts and tumult of emotions. Considering that Darcy just had his hopes dashed (yet again!) in securing Elizabeth's hand and that he considers himself at fault for the mess Lydia is in, I do not think he is out of character.

The other two characters who have the most page time are Lydia and Wickham, and their characterizations are absolutely spot-on. In fact, I have never read a better depiction of Lydia. She is thoughtlessly loyal to Wickham, who is charmingly two-faced. One almost despairs along with Darcy at his attempts to negotiate with Wickham and to convince Lydia to remove herself from her poorly chosen situation.

I cannot really give away the plot, as we all know how it turns out. The purpose of the tale is not to surprise the reader, but to show what Darcy did and why he did it from his viewpoint. There are many Darcy POV fics out there, but this one is particularly well done.

This is an excellent story, and I highly recommend it.

06:34 am Ghosts and Guardians by GreenWoman (PG)
Fandom: THE MAGNIFICENT SEVEN
Pairing: Author labels gen, but Ezra/OFC, and a hint of Chris/Mary
Length: ~6,000
Author on LJ: [livejournal.com profile] greenwoman
Author Website: GreenWoman's HALF AFT
Why this must be read:

My next several recs will be stories that focus on Ezra Standish, M7's odd man out. A professional con man and card sharp, he is pulled into the Seven against his will, and only gradually finds his place amongst the others and earns their trust (and his own).

In this story, Ezra has a fortuitous encounter with a woman new to town. The title gives away the story's twist, but, really, the story isn't a mystery, it's an examination of what makes Ezra tick, and how he may have, and need, more support from more quarters - natural and supernatural - than one might think.
